TICKET-4182: EXIF scrub bypass via rotated thumbnails

Severity: high. The Pixmere upload pipeline strips EXIF from the primary image but not from embedded thumbnails when orientation is 6 or 8.

Repro:
1. Upload rotated JPEG with GPS tags via /v2/media.
2. Fetch the derived thumbnail.
3. Inspect metadata — GPS fields survive.

Runs against the Pixmere staging tenant; to reproduce, call the endpoint with the token below.

bearer token for bawip-kafog: eyJhbGciOiJIUzI1NiIsInR5cCI6IkpXVCJ9.eyJzdWIiOiIgiGSzwTL8YIn0.yfGhHG1oCOur

TICKET: logtail-cli config drift

The `tailgrub` CLI on the Brimward fleet no longer matches the checked-in baseline. Three hosts have divergent buffer sizes and one has retention overrides nobody remembers setting. Result: inconsistent tail latency during Tuesday's incident review.

Proposal: re-sync from the baseline repo, add a drift check to the nightly audit. Needs a decision at sync. For reference, the drifted values currently in effect are as follows.

service settings:
[pelius]
port = 5432
team = praius
host = pelius.crelvoforge.internal
region = upper-4
access_code = ac_8f224d
timeout_ms = 2000

## Runbook — fleet fuel-usage report

Runs nightly on the Oxhollow scheduler. Pulls odometer and fuel deltas per vehicle, aggregates weekly, writes to the reporting bucket. If totals look off, check for missed ingest windows first. Rerun is safe; output is overwritten per date. The job reads its runtime settings from the block below.

config for kafof-bawef:
holath:
  log_level: debug
  metrics_host: metrics.holath.qorvelsys.internal
  pin: 2191
  pool_size: 32

Docwarden is our documentation linter. It runs in CI on every merge to the Fennel repo and posts findings to the build log. It holds no user data; the only sensitive item is the token it uses to fetch private style rules. That token lives in one .env line:

sealed setting: LEDGER_TOKEN13=5d842615a26d7